Once again, the Department of Science and Technology takes science, technology and innovation cyber center stage as the virtual 2021 National Science and Technology Week (NSTW) Celebration will be held from 22-28 November 2021. With the theme “Agham at Teknolohiya: Tugon sa Hamon ng Panahon”, this year’s S&T Week continues the resounding success of the first virtual NSTW in 2020.
As a prelude to this event, DOST Region V will conduct the Pre-NSTW Celebration back-to-back with the Bicol Regional Invention Contest and Exhibits (BRICE) on 12-14 October 2021 via virtual platforms. With the limitations posed by the COVID-19 pandemic, DOST-V cascades the myriad activities of the Pre-NSTW to the Bicolanos at the comfort of their digital devices, computers and smartphones, at home or in the office.

Pushing the local micro, small, and medium enterprises (MSMEs) towards smarter and resilient industry players, the Department of Science and Technology-National Capital Region held the virtual kickoff for the Small Enterprise Upgrading Program (DOST-NCR SETUP) e-Caravan, a week-long series of virtual and face-to-face activities to promote the upgraded services of SETUP 4.0.
The SETUP e-Caravan presents the various technology assistance for the MSMEs which include capacity building, technology upgrading, consultancies, and manufacturing enhancement assistance, especially during this time of the COVID-19 pandemic.

Maya-3 and Maya-4 now flying high as space technology takes up space in the upcoming Science Week
- Details
- Hits: 2146
The country is flying high with its aggressive thrust of harnessing the power of space technology by developing microsatellites, cube satellites, and nanosatellites that can be used for various applications.
Maya-3 and Maya-4, the first Philippine university-built cube satellites (CubeSats), are now in orbit after their successful deployment from the International Space Station (ISS) on Wednesday, 06 October 2021. The so-called ‘cousin’ of these two cube satellites is Maya-1 which is the first Filipino cube satellite that was developed under the Philippine Scientific Earth Observation Microsatellite program (PHL-Microsat).

The Information and Communications Technologies (ICT) enabled products and services have become even more relevant and necessary for the local health sector especially during the COVID-19 pandemic as the government seeks alternative and safer means to provide health related services to its citizenry as well as to healthcare workers.
In a virtual discussion dubbed, “Talakayang HeaRT Beat on ICT for Health Projects” held on 29 September 2021, four projects supported by the Philippine Council for Health Research and Development of the Department of Science and Technology (DOST-PCHRD) were featured. Two of which happen to have found novel and noble purposes during the pandemic.
